Responsibilities :

Basic janitorial duties to include, but not limited to, vacuuming, mopping, cleaning and emptying waste baskets

Answering calls from leadership and other associates to help customers with issues such as spills, wet floors, and general clean up

Picking up trash in the parking lot

Sanitation of the facility restrooms and its fixtures

Reporting any needed repairs to supervisor such as leaky faucets, toilets, loose tiles or broken fixtures

Train new associates and follows up on facilities team duties

Performing the above tasks while maintaining a safe environment within the facility

Maintain orderly appearance of personal work space and surrounding areas

Other duties that may be assigned by supervisor, as needed

All duties require a positive attitude toward coworkers and customers

Physical Requirements / Lifting Requirements :

Must be able to sit, stand, bend at the waist, climb, stoop, kneel, crouch, reach, walk, push / pull, lift, talk, and hear with or without reasonable accommodation.

Heavy work Exerting up to 100 pounds of force occasionally, and / or up to 50 pounds of force frequently, and / or up to 20 pounds of force constantly to move objects.

Scheels cares about the health and safety of our Associates. Associates are expected to follow all safety procedures and perform their job duties in a fashion that minimizes the risk of injury.
